## Ticket: Config drift in LedgerLens staging

While reviewing the LedgerLens audit-log viewer, I noticed staging has diverged from the committed manifest: retention window and pagination size no longer match what's in the repo. Please compare carefully before changing anything, since prod reads the same template. Document each difference in a comment before reconciling. For reference, the expected values currently deployed to staging are as follows.

settings of tagef-bawif:
DRUIX_HOST=druix.zemvarlabs.internal
DRUIX_PORT=8000

## FeeForge Rules Engine — On-call Notes

If shipping fees start coming back as zero, it's almost always the rules engine at Parcelwick failing to load its ruleset, not the checkout service. Restart the FeeForge pod first; it re-fetches rules on boot. If quotes are merely wrong (not zero), check whether someone pushed a draft ruleset to prod again — yes, it happens. Before digging further, confirm the runtime matches what's below. The current production configuration is as follows.

deployment values, kajep-kageg:
[praix]
host = praix.paliqcorp.corp
user = praix_svc
database = praix_prod

## Runbook: Spokewise rebalancer stalls

If the Spokewise rebalancing tool stops assigning van routes, check the dock-fill cache first — stale snapshots older than 20 minutes cause silent no-ops. Restart the planner pod, then verify at least one route appears within two cycles. Escalate to the Bellhaven ops rota if not. When filing the ticket, include the planner's trace token shown below.

pipeline stamp: htk6_35e0c9

Subject: Secrets-rotation cut-over complete

Team, the move from the old Keyturner scripts to the new Vaultling utility finished last night without incident. All Briarfield services now rotate on the shorter schedule, and the legacy cron entries have been removed. For anyone maintaining this later, the values Vaultling was deployed with are listed below.

config for bahop-fajep:
DRUATH_PIN=4501
DRUATH_TENANT=briwyn
DRUATH_METRICS_HOST=metrics.druath.brasksoft.test
DRUATH_SEAL=seal_7d2e069d
DRUATH_STANDBY_TEAM=olieth